Transaction d764405735f41c92699e27f15e820829ca91fb650480f3eee9b0eef968f4e072

1 Input
1 Outputs
  • d764405735f41c92699e27f15e820829ca91fb650480f3eee9b0eef968f4e072:0
  • value  1271348
    address  16QDCTSSELpHxDohpAgn5RLfqAC1sYCt8a